Advance Care Planning (ACP)

Updated: Nov 27, 2023


Every adult has the right to decide what medical care they think is best for them. Planning for your healthcare ahead of time allows others to honor your healthcare choices if you are unable to speak for yourself. Advance Care Planning (ACP) lets you choose someone to be your spokesperson (who can speak for you when you cannot) and tell healthcare providers what to do for your medical care.
